Why 0-15-15 Fertilizer Is Necessary
I use 0-15-15 fertilizer when I want to give my plants the nutrients they need without adding extra nitrogen. The “0” means there is no nitrogen, which is helpful when my soil already has enough of it or when I do not want to push too much leafy growth. The “15” and “15” provide phosphorus and potassium, two nutrients that support strong roots, better flowering, and overall plant health.
I find this fertilizer especially useful for flowering plants, fruiting crops, and root development. Phosphorus helps my plants establish better roots and encourages blooms, while potassium improves plant strength, stress tolerance, and fruit quality. When I want healthier flowers or a better harvest, this balanced phosphorus-potassium mix can make a big difference.
My experience is that 0-15-15 is a smart choice when I need targeted feeding. It helps me correct nutrient needs more precisely instead of using a fertilizer that adds everything at once. That makes it a practical option for improving growth where it matters most.

How I Compare Different Products
When I compare brands, I look at the ingredient source, whether the fertilizer is water-soluble or granular, and how easy it is to apply. I also compare the price per pound or per application so I can tell which option gives me better value. If I am feeding potted plants, I often prefer a product that mixes easily with water. For garden beds, I may choose a granular version for slower release.
What I Check on the Label
I always check the N-P-K ratio, application instructions, and whether the fertilizer is suitable for my specific plants. I also look for any added micronutrients like magnesium, sulfur, or trace minerals, because those can make a difference in plant performance. If the label gives clear feeding rates, I feel more confident using it correctly.
Best Uses I Have Found
In my experience, 0 15 15 fertilizer is especially helpful for:
- Flowering plants that need better bloom support
- Fruit-bearing plants during production stages
- Root development in young or transplanted plants
- Soils that already have enough nitrogen
How I Apply It Safely
I follow the package directions closely because too much fertilizer can damage plants. I usually apply it to moist soil and avoid overfeeding. If I am using a liquid form, I measure carefully and mix it exactly as instructed. I also keep it away from direct contact with stems and leaves unless the label says it is safe to do otherwise.
